Dominick D. Nichols, 72

Troy Dominick D. Nichols, 72, of Hutton St. died Sunday, August 7, 2005 after an automobile accident in Florida.

Born in Troy, he was the son of the late Charles Nichols and Mary (Cazzillo) Nichols of the Beman Park area.

He was longtime resident of Troy. He was loved by all he met.

Mr. Nichols was an area business owner and operator for many years.

He was a member of Knights of Columbus, CRAB Club, Troy Lodge of Elks, Emerald Athletic Club, All-Troy Athletic Club and many others and was an Air Force veteran of the Korean War.

He is survived by two sons, Ron Nichols (Julie Severance) of Waterford and Mike Nussbaumer (Leslie) of Alabama; two daughters, Melissa Shufon (Steven) of Troy and Debbie Nichols of Troy; a son-in-law, Mark Balistreri of Troy; his grandchildren, Joshua and Breeanna Nichols, Donny Batchelor and Jordan Nussbaumer; two aunts, Dolores Snyder of FL and Antoinette 'Tootie' Brown of Troy; a nephew and a niece, Greg and Dolores. He was predeceased by his daughter, Annette Balistreri and son, Donnie Nichols.

Funeral service will be held Monday at 11:00 AM at the Our Lady of Victory Church 55 North Lake Avenue Troy where a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ated with Rev. Randall Patterson, Pastor, officiating.

Relatives and friends may call at the Bryce Funeral Home Inc. 276 Pawling Avenue Troy Sunday from 4:00 PM to 8:00 PM.

Interment St. Mary's Cemetery in Troy.
